摘要
核电机组大修集体剂量,主要受机组辐射水平和检修总工时影响.本文介绍了核电机组大修集体剂量的控制方法,从完善辐射防护组织、集体剂量目标分解、热点冲洗、创新检修工具、创新检修工艺、高辐射区域管控等方面总结了某核电厂 2 台CPR1000 机组共 10 次大修集体剂量的控制经验.
Abstract
This article analyzes the two main factors affecting collective dose during outage of nuclear power units-namely the reactor unit radiation levels and the total maintenance working hours-and their control meth-ods.This article summarizes the experience gained from controlling collective dose during ten outages of two CPR1000 units at a particular nuclear power plant.Which includes enhancing radiation protection organiza-tions,allocating collective dose targets,conducting hot spot flushing,developing innovative maintenance tools and techniques,improving maintenance processes,and managing high level radiation areas.These experi-ences have been validated through practical implementation and proven to be effective.
